About EMERGE PR, but better. At EMERGE, we work with category defining brands placing them in the hearts, minds and phone screens of their target Consumer groups. PR is not one-size-fits-all and neither is the Consumer, we operate across category in order to generate impactful communications that directly reach the audiences that matter.
About the role Senior Account Executives at EMERGE are bright and enthusiastic with a go-getter attitude. They have a genuine passion for brand communications, with the ability to contribute in a fast-paced, creative environment and use their initiative to achieve client results.
As a key part of the account team, SAEs are responsible for executing day to day press office confidently for clients. Creating engaging pitches and landing coverage from product placement, to trends, and commentary for a range of EMERGE clients across sectors. SAEs are extremely organised, able to manage trackers, deadlines, inboxes and critical paths with ease.

SAEs have a good understanding of the UK PR landscape, are excited by Consumer brands and want to contribute creativity and ideas to client events and campaigns.
Relevant Industry Experience
- 2+ years of PR experience, ideally within an agency
- Ability to work in a fast-paced environment, juggling multiple accounts
- Hard working and reliable member of the team
- Strong written and verbal communication skills
- Well organised and methodical approach to daily tasks and inbox management
- Confident communicator with the ability to present during client calls and meetings
- Well versed with computer software including; Googlemail, Outlook, Excel, Powerpoint and Canva
- Creative thinker and writer to secure media coverage across EMERGE clients
- Understanding of the VIP, influencer and KOL landscape
- Ability to curate guest lists and gifting lists for a range of client type
